2 Fig 1 Transillumination of the aortic root after dissection of the subvalvular plane with view from the (A) noncoronary (NC) sinus and from the (B) right cusp (RC)–left cusp (LC) commissure. (C) Open ring (Extra-Aortic Open Ring, CORONEO, Inc, Montreal, QC, Canada) for isolated aortic valve repair with subvalvular annuloplasty without coronary detachment. (D) Remodeling root reconstruction associated to expansible (25-mm diameter × 3-mm cross-section) aortic annuloplasty ring (Extra-Aortic Low Profile, CORONEO, Inc) for root aneurysm repair with a Gelweave Valsalva tube (Vascutek/Terumo, Renfrewshire, United Kingdom). 3 Fig 2 (A) The aortic root has been opened at the commissural level in between the right and left coronary sinuses and spread apart, and the cusps were removed. The blue line indicates the sinotubular junction (STJ), and the green line indicates the aortic annulus (AA). The scale drawing shows the subvalvular dissection plane line and the schematic 3-dimensional aortic annular view from the (B) right (R) cusp, (C) noncoronary (NC) cusp, and (D) left (L) cusp.
